#369bd4 is a balanced vivid blue, 202° on the wheel and 97/100 on the cool side. Put black text on it (6.80:1). As text it scores 3.09:1 on white — large text only. Nearest name is Dodger Blue, nearest Tailwind family is sky.

Large text — 24px regular or 18.66px bold and above — only needs 3:1, so #369BD4 is enough for headings on white. Non-text elements such as icons, chart strokes and focus rings also sit at 3:1 under WCAG 2.2 (1.4.11).

Roughly one man in twelve has some form of colour vision deficiency. If any of the three panels above is hard to tell apart from a neighbouring colour in your palette, add a shape, an icon or a label so the meaning does not rest on hue alone.

#369bd4, answered

What color is #369bd4?

#369bd4 is a balanced vivid blue, closest to Dodger Blue (ΔE2000 8). It sits at 202° on the hue wheel with 65% saturation and 52% lightness, which reads as cool.

What is the RGB value of #369bd4?

rgb(54, 155, 212) — 54 red, 155 green and 212 blue out of 255, or 21.2% / 60.8% / 83.1% by channel.

What is #369bd4 in HSL and HSV?

hsl(202, 65%, 52%) and hsv(202, 75%, 83%). HSL is what CSS takes; HSV is what your design tool's picker shows, which is why the saturation numbers rarely match.

Is #369bd4 a light or a dark color?

It is a mid-tone. Relative luminance is 0.2898 and perceived brightness is 56%, so black text on it reaches 6.80:1.

Should I use black or white text on #369bd4?

Black. It scores 6.80:1 against #369bd4, versus 3.09:1 for white — AA at any size.

Is #369bd4 accessible on a white background?

#369bd4 on white scores 3.09:1, which only clears AA for large text — 18.66px bold or 24px regular and up. Darken it to #257CAD to reach 4.5:1, or #1C5E83 for 7:1.
